Summary of differences between green beans and shark fin soup

  • Green beans have more fiber, vitamin A, manganese, vitamin C, and folate, while shark fin soup has more vitamin B12, copper, and zinc.
  • Shark fin soup covers your daily need for sodium, 22% more than green beans.
  • The amount of sodium in green beans is lower.

These are the specific foods used in this comparison Beans, snap, green, cooked, boiled, drained, without salt and Soup, shark fin, restaurant-prepared.
